Part of our-messaging team … WebYou can use Outlook on the web for business to give someone in your organization permission to manage your calendar. You can give them editor access, which lets them edit your calendar, or delegate access, which lets them not only edit your calendar, but also schedule and respond to meetings on your behalf.
